Metastasis of breast cancer to the thyroid gland a case report and review of literature

Background
Metastasis to the thyroid is not as rare as previously was believed. Its incidence has been shown in autopsy series, to be more than the incidence of primary thyroid malignancy. Breast cancer is the most common cancer in women and one of the cancers that metastasize to the thyroid gland.We had a young patient with breast cancer who presented with thyroid mass confirmed to be a metastasis from breast cancer so we reviewed the literature.
Material And Methods
We reviewed all available papers about secondary thyroid malignancies from 1960 to 2007.Total of 41 papers were found that most of them had discussions about breast cancer metastasis to the thyroid gland. We extracted the incidence, time between diagnosis of breast cancer and thyroid involvement, common signs and diagnosis and treatments that were recommended.
Results
The overall incidence of metastasis in the thyroid gland varies from 1.25% in unselected autopsy series to 25% in autopsy of patients with widespread malignancies. The most frequent metastasis to thyroid is from renal cancer, lung cancer and breast cancer. The time between breast cancer diagnosis and metastasis to the thyroid has been reported 2 to 180 months. Almost inarticles breast cancer was one of three most common cancers with tendency for metastasis to the thyroid. The presenting symptom was thyroid solitary or multiple nodule, the diagnosis was made by FNA in most cases but core or open biopsy was necessary in few patients for diagnosis. Treatment was thyroidectomy or lobectomy in most patients except for patients with widespread metastasis to other organs that were treated with chemotherapy alone.
Conclusion
Breast cancer is one of most common cancers that metastasize to thyroid gland. It its recommended in any patient with a known history of previous carcinoma, the appearance of a new thyroid mass should be regarded as potentially metastasis. If we consider high incidence of breast cancer among women and also high incidence of thyroid masses in Iranian women, we find it is not a rare condition if we meet a breast cancer survivor who has thyroid mass too. So it is important for a clinician to have enough information about thyroid metastatic cancers.
